Cash boost for courier

Specialist courier company, PDQ, has received a £250,000 cash boost to enhance its state-of-the-art fleet. PDQ prides itself on offering a ‘white glove service’ to blue chip companies, transporting consignments worth more than £300m every year, in the the UK, Ireland and Europe.

The dedicated temperature controlled, time sensitive service is used to convey everything from pathology samples and pharmaceuticals, to hazardous materials.

Gary Fletcher, Barclays corporate relationship manager said: “This is a significant investment in a competitive market and paints a very bright future for the business.”

PDQ employs specialist drivers, in a fleet of tri-temperature controlled vehicles, ranging from -25 to +30 degrees, offering refrigerated, controlled room temperature and frozen storage. The company also offers MHRA-approved storage facilities, bio-hazardous logistics and air freight from all their offices.
